About 3-[1-(1-ethylazetidin-3-yl)pyrazol-4-yl]-5,7-difluoro-6-[(6-methyl-[1,2,4]triazolo[4,3-b]pyridazin-3-yl)methyl]quinoline

3-[1-(1-ethylazetidin-3-yl)pyrazol-4-yl]-5,7-difluoro-6-[(6-methyl-[1,2,4]triazolo[4,3-b]pyridazin-3-yl)methyl]quinoline (PubChem CID 59320224) has the molecular formula C24H22F2N8 and a molecular weight of 460.49 g/mol. Its IUPAC name is 3-[1-(1-ethylazetidin-3-yl)pyrazol-4-yl]-5,7-difluoro-6-[(6-methyl-[1,2,4]triazolo[4,3-b]pyridazin-3-yl)methyl]quinoline.
